How much do cna travel j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for cna travel in Rochester, NY is $19.80,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.11 and $22.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a CNA travel?

A CNA travel job is a temporary certified nursing assistant position that requires traveling to different healthcare facilities, such as hospitals, nursing homes, or rehab centers. Travel CNAs fill staffing shortages in various locations, often working through staffing agencies that arrange assignments. These positions offer competitive pay, housing stipends, and the opportunity to gain experience in different medical settings. Travel CNAs must have an active CNA license and meet state-specific requirements for each assignment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the CNA travel position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a CNA Travel, you need a valid Certified Nursing Assistant certification, clinical care experience, and proficiency in providing patient support in various healthcare settings.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), patient monitoring devices, and standard medical documentation is important. Strong communication, adaptability, and organizational skills help CNAs excel while frequently adjusting to new teams and environments. These abilities are crucial for delivering consistent, high-quality care across different facilities and meeting the unique needs of each assignment.

What kinds of schedules and locations should I expect when working as a CNA travel professional?

As a CNA Travel professional, you can expect to work in a variety of healthcare settings, such as hospitals, long-term care facilities, and rehabilitation centers, often in regions experiencing staffing shortages. Assignments typically range from several weeks to a few months, and you may need to work day, evening, or night shifts depending on employer needs. Flexibility with location and scheduling is important, as travel CNAs are often placed where demand is highest. This dynamic environment offers the opportunity to gain diverse clinical experience and expand your professional network while helping facilities maintain quality patient care.

Do travel CNAs make more money?

Travel CNAs typically earn higher wages than stationary CNAs due to the temporary nature of assignments, often including additional stipends for housing and travel expenses. Their pay can vary based on location, demand, and experience, but overall, travel CNA positions tend to offer increased compensation compared to traditional roles.

How to get a job as a travel CNA?

To become a travel CNA, you need to obtain a state-certified nursing assistant license, gain experience in healthcare settings, and then apply through staffing agencies that specialize in travel healthcare. These agencies handle assignments, housing, and logistics, and often require CPR certification and a clean background check.

Job Title: CNA - Neurobehavioral Unit
Location: Newark, NY
Pay: $22.20 per hour
Shifts: Variable, including weekends
Seven Healthcare are seeking a dedicated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) for a travel contract in Newark, NY. This role involves caring for residents on a neurobehavioral unit specializing in Alzheimer's and dementia. The unit provides a secured and structured environment for individuals with unpredictable aggressive behaviors.

Key Responsibilities of the CNA
  • Provide comprehensive care to residents with Alzheimer's and dementia
  • Assist with ambulation, feeding, and daily hygiene tasks
  • Perform routine catheter care and manage incontinence care
  • Support behavioral management strategies and discharge planning
  • Maintain safety within the structured environment
Requirements of the CNA
  • Active BLS certification
  • Minimum 1 year of relevant experience
  • Experience with EPIC charting system is required
  • Willingness to float as per facility needs
  • Ability to work every other weekend
